About H. Duroy

H. Duroy is a scholar working on Materials Chemistry, Inorganic Chemistry, Electrical and Electronic Engineering, Electronic, Optical and Magnetic Materials and Condensed Matter Physics, having authored 23 papers that have together received 2.9k indexed citations. Recurring topics across this work include Inorganic Fluorides and Related Compounds (12 papers), Ferroelectric and Piezoelectric Materials (7 papers), Inorganic Chemistry and Materials (6 papers), Crystal Structures and Properties (5 papers), Microwave Dielectric Ceramics Synthesis (4 papers), Layered Double Hydroxides Synthesis and Applications (4 papers), X-ray Diffraction in Crystallography (4 papers) and Advanced Battery Materials and Technologies (3 papers). The work is most often cited by research in Inorganic Chemistry (813 citations), Electronic, Optical and Magnetic Materials (935 citations), Materials Chemistry (2.1k citations), Physical and Theoretical Chemistry (343 citations) and Industrial and Manufacturing Engineering (282 citations). H. Duroy has collaborated with scholars based in France and United States. Frequent co-authors include J.L. Fourquet, A. Le Bail, Marie‐Pierre Crosnier‐Lopez, Nattamai S. P. Bhuvanesh, C. Bohnké, M. Leblanc, R. De Pape, C. Jacoboni, O. Bohnké and Ph. Lacorre. Their work appears in journals such as Journal of Solid State Chemistry, Materials Research Bulletin, Journal of Materials Chemistry, Chemistry of Materials and Sensors and Actuators B Chemical.
